5. Fatigue actions

5.1 Origins and standards

  • Fatigue actions, resulting from stress fluctuations, can come from the following sources:

    • superimposed moving loads, including machine vibrations in fixed structures ;

    • loads due to exposure conditions, such as wind, swell, etc. ;

    • acceleration forces in moving structures ;

    • dynamic response due to resonance effects.

  • Fatigue loads are generally defined in the various parts of Eurocode 1 :

    • NF EN 1991-1-4 for wind ;

    • NF EN 1991-2 for bridges ;
